Comparison between Intel Core i5-12500 and Intel Core i3-4170
Both CPUs are manufactured by Intel.
Intel Core i3-4170 has a higher base speed of 3.7 GHz compared to Intel Core i5-12500's 3.0 GHz.
Intel Core i5-12500 has a higher turbo speed of 4.6 GHz compared to Intel Core i3-4170's GHz.
Intel Core i5-12500 has more cores (6) compared to Intel Core i3-4170's 2 cores.
Intel Core i5-12500 supports more threads (12) compared to Intel Core i3-4170's 4 threads.
Both CPUs belong to the same class: Desktop.
Intel Core i5-12500 uses the LGA socket, while Intel Core i3-4170 uses the LGA1150 socket.
Intel Core i5-12500 was launched in Q1 2022, while Intel Core i3-4170 was launched in Q2 2015.
Intel Core i5-12500 has a larger L3 cache of 18 MB compared to Intel Core i3-4170's 3 MB.
